An integral part of the Supply Chain team, this role is primarily responsible for generating the production schedule for the Cork site, organising production to meet customers' demands. 

The role:

  • Ensuring capacity (labour and machine), materials and design are available to meet customer requested dates
  • Update production variances and adjust the production plan for best results
  • Inventory control and material usage in production
  • Root cause analysis for variance from plan; facilitate process improvements to reduce inventory and optimize the flow of product through production
  • Liaison with operations, engineering and shipping teams to review production plan and performance metrics
  • Maintain and analyse all production planning performance metrics
  • Work with Master Scheduler and Purchasing to understand longer-term demand requirements and ensure raw material supply plan can support business plan
